Company Overview:Method Co. is in search of a dynamic Hotel General Manager to lead The Quoin Hotel in Wilmington, DE. We are dedicated to providing exceptional service and memorable experiences for our guests. The Ideal Candidate:A visionary leader with a robust background in managing boutique hotels. You are known for your operational acumen and your ability to hire, mentor, and drive a team towards achieving outstanding results. As the face of The Quoin Hotel, you will play a pivotal role in staff recruitment, training, and motivation. Key Responsibilities:Lead the recruitment, training, and management of staff across front office, maintenance, and housekeeping departments.Oversee sales and profitability while controlling operational costs.Establish and enforce standards for staff performance and guest service, ensuring consistency with Method Co.'s values.Implement guest service programs to enhance guest satisfaction across the hotel.Demonstrate adaptability to change and openness to innovative ideas and new responsibilities.Employ effective revenue management strategies to optimize financial performance.Review and interpret financial statements to inform strategic planning.Formulate and administer the hotel's budget, facilitating fiscal planning for all departments.Maintain a strong presence within the hotel, ensuring accessibility to guests, staff, and vendors, and fostering open lines of communication with department managers.Ensure a high level of guest satisfaction by addressing feedback and resolving any issues promptly.Guide, supervise, and evaluate staff performance, fostering a culture of recognition and professional development. Qualifications:Bachelor's degree in Hospitality Management, Business Administration, or related field.Minimum of 5 years of hotel management experience.Proven track record of sales excellence and revenue generation, with experience in developing and implementing successful sales strategies.Demonstrated ability in financial planning, budget management, and workforce prehensive understanding of hotel operations including front desk, housekeeping, maintenance, and especially sales and marketing.Experience in successfully leading and motivating a team to achieve operational and sales targets.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with a demonstrated ability to effectively negotiate and close deals.Adept at responding to complex inquiries or complaints from guests, regulatory agencies, or business partners.Analytical skills with a strong focus on data-driven decision-making and a detail-oriented approach to problem-solving.Proficiency in hotel management software, CRM systems, and familiarity with online booking and sales platforms.
